Transaction 8915e71e50865d3ce9a2c7f18d63a17912e7401c3a8dd5e7a449aeab6ee7158a
1 Input
1 Output
-
8915e71e50865d3ce9a2c7f18d63a17912e7401c3a8dd5e7a449aeab6ee7158a:0
- value
- 105123
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a6558ba5d9e18db833110957b7110977947a584 OP_EQUAL
- address
- 32dz69UDaYtvtFW8fAxTLdnx6hPNJ36VE9